摘要:利用多酶级联催化反应合成精细化学品是近年来生物催化领域的研究热点。通过构建体外多酶级联体系,可以替代传统的化学合成法,实现多种双官能团功能化学品的绿色合成。本文系统介绍了多酶级联催化反应中不同级联方式的特点及其构建策略,总结了级联反应中元件酶常用的筛选方法、NAD(P)H和ATP等辅酶的再生策略及其在多酶级联反应中的应用,并且阐述了多酶级联催化反应体系在6种双官能团功能化学品,包括ω-氨基脂肪酸、烷基内酰胺、α,ω-二元羧酸、α,ω-二胺、α,ω-二醇、ω-氨基醇合成中的应用。
The synthesis of fine chemicals using multi-enzyme cascade reactions is a recent hot research topic in the field of biocatalysis.The traditional chemical synthesis methods were replaced by constructing in vitro multi-enzyme cascades,then the green synthesis of a variety of bifunctional chemicals can be achieved.This article summarizes the construction strategies of different types of multi-enzyme cascade reactions and their characteristics.In addition,the general methods for recruiting enzymes used in cascade reactions,as well as the regeneration of coenzyme such as NAD(P)H or ATP and their application in multi-enzyme cascade reactions are summarized.Finally,we illustrate the application of multi-enzyme cascades in the synthesis of six bifunctional chemicals,includingω-amino fatty acids,alkyl lactams,α,ω-dicarboxylic acids,α,ω-diamines,α,ω-diols,andω-amino alcohols.
